U.S. Food and Drug Administration Web/Visual Designer Salary

The average U.S. Food and Drug Administration Web/Visual Designer earns an estimated $95,972 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$86,999 with a $8,973 bonus. U.S. Food and Drug Administration's Web/Visual Designer compensation is $1,455,131 less than the US average for a Web/Visual Designer. Web/Visual Designer salaries at U.S. Food and Drug Administration can range from $50,000 - $132,000.

The Design Department at U.S. Food and Drug Administration earns $554 more on average than the IT Department.
